Hugh Wilson of JetFinders and Project Phoenix Killed in Air CrashHugh Wilson, beloved friend and colleague in the aviation industry, died on a charity flight to raise money for his church. The light aircraft he was flying crashed in a field near Sourton Caundie, Dorset. Wilson, 63, was found dead at the scene by paramedics. Hugh Wilson had more than 35 years of experience in the aviation industry. An experienced pilot, Wilson learned to fly in the Royal Air Force University Air Squadron at Leeds, afterward maintaining his license privately. Over the course of his career, Wilson worked with such aviation luminaries as Cessna, Bombardier, Gulfstream and Rolls Royce. Wilson was Managing Director for JetFinders, a worldwide jet sourcing and sales company based in the United Kingdom. A warm and knowledgeable gentleman, he will be sorely missed.
